However, it is worth noting that Vakula is also the name of a character in the Russian novel "Evenings on a Farm Near Dikanka," written by Nikolai Gogol. Vakula is portrayed as a blacksmith who strikes a deal with the devil to win the love of a beautiful girl. This character has become quite popular in Russian folklore and is often associated with winter holidays.
